In scientific notation, the letter E is used to mean “10 to the power of.” For example, 1.314E+1 means 1.314 * 10 1 which is 13.14 . Web8.000 includes four significant figures 800. includes three significant figures 0.080 includes two significant figures 5) If the number does not have a decimal point, trailing zeros are not significant. For example: 500 or 5 × 10^2 only includes one significant figure 51000 includes two significant figures

WebHow many sig figs in 10.0? Answer: 3. Using the significant figures of 10.0, we can express 10.0 in Scientific Notation and E-notation: Scientific Notation: 10.0 = 1.00 × 101. E-notation: 10.0 = 1.00e+1. Significant Figures Calculator. Use the Significant Figures Calculator to determine how many significant figures there are in a number and ... WebHow many significant figures does 1.00 have? 1.00 has 3 significant figures and 2 decimals. 1.00 rounded to 2 sig figs is 1.0, and to 1 sig figs is 1. To count the number of sig figs in …

Web14 jun. 2024 · 1. In terms of significant figures, you always use the number with least amount of sig figs to determine how many sig figs your answer has. In this case, one number has 3 sig figs, and the other has 1. Therefore your answer should have 1 sig fig and be 1 mol/L, as you said.
